Opinion: Justin Calabrese Says America Doesn't Have an Entrepreneur Problem - It Has a Courage Problem
MANHATTAN, N.Y. - EntSun -- Entrepreneur, author, and business consultant Justin Calabrese believes the greatest challenge facing American entrepreneurship isn't inflation, artificial intelligence, politics, or a lack of funding—it's a growing reluctance to embrace risk, accountability, and uncertainty.
According to Calabrese, aspiring entrepreneurs have more access than ever to business education, mentorship, technology, funding opportunities, and free resources. Yet many continue waiting for the "perfect time" to launch a business, blaming outside circumstances instead of focusing on what they can control. "We don't have a shortage of entrepreneurs—we have a shortage of people willing to take responsibility for their own success," he said.
Calabrese argues that too many struggling businesses spend their energy pointing to economic conditions, competition, AI, or social media algorithms rather than examining leadership, customer experience, execution, and adaptability. While external challenges are real, he believes successful entrepreneurs distinguish themselves by responding to change instead of waiting for it to disappear.

He is also critical of what he calls the "fake entrepreneur economy" fueled by social media, where appearances often overshadow substance. According to Calabrese, entrepreneurship has become increasingly associated with luxury lifestyles, viral content, and personal branding instead of profitability, resilience, and solving real customer problems. In his view, too many people want the image of entrepreneurship without accepting the sacrifices that come with building a successful business.
Calabrese believes education also plays a role by preparing students to enter the workforce while giving comparatively little attention to creating future employers and innovators. He argues that if failure continues to be viewed as something to avoid rather than a lesson to learn from, fewer people will be willing to take the calculated risks that drive economic growth.
Rather than fearing artificial intelligence, Calabrese sees it as exposing businesses that never developed strong fundamentals. Companies that understand their customers, deliver value, and continuously adapt, he says, will continue to succeed regardless of technological change.

His message to entrepreneurs is straightforward: stop waiting. Markets will never be perfect, competition will never disappear, and certainty is never guaranteed. Success belongs to those willing to execute despite uncertainty.
About Justin Calabrese
Justin Calabrese is an entrepreneur, author, consultant, and educator whose work focuses on entrepreneurship, leadership, organizational development, and small business growth. The opinions expressed in this release are his own and are intended to encourage discussion about the future of entrepreneurship and business leadership.
